What is Green Resources PCL EBIT?

Green Resources PCL BKK:GREEN +1.43% 39 EBIT is ฿6.2 Mil as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ates BKK:GREEN with a GF Score™ of 39/100 and a GF Value™ of ฿0.84 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review.

Green Resources PCL's ear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was ฿12.6 Mil. Its ear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was ฿6.2 Mil.

EBIT or Operating Income is linked to Return on Capital for both regular definition and Joel Greenblatt's definition. Green Resources PCL's annualized ROC %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was -0.22%. Green Resources PCL's annualized ROC (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 10.00%.

EBIT is also linked to Joel Greenblatt's definition of earnings yield. Green Resources PCL's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 1.07%.

Green Resources PCL EBIT Calculation

E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was ฿6.2 Mil.

Green Resources PCL Business Description

Address 405 Bond Street Road, Soi 13, Bang Pood Subdistrict, Pak Kret District, Nonthaburi, THA, 11120
Green Resources PCL is engaged in the business of real estate development, generation and distribution of electricity from solar, sale of goods with the installation of solar-cell systems. The company's segments include Real Estate, Rental and related services, and Energy generated from solar-cell systems. It derives the majority of the revenue from Energy generating from the solar-cell segment. The Group operates in a single geographical area in Thailand.
